What this job asks for AI summary

A hands-on technical role centered on configuring, developing, and maintaining a ServiceNow GRC/IRM platform, with particular emphasis on Policy and Compliance Management and Audit Management modules. Day-to-day work involves building automation for control attestations and repetitive compliance processes, mapping policies to controls, and supporting internal and external audits alongside cybersecurity and IT compliance teams. Suits an experienced ServiceNow developer with a certified background and familiarity with frameworks such as NIST and ITIL.
